National Institute for Environmental Studies and Chugin Financial Group Sign Comprehensive Partnership Agreement

The National Institute for Environmental Studies (NIES) and Chugin Financial Group have entered into a comprehensive partnership to promote regional sustainable development through the sustainable use of environmental capital. The 3-year agreement focuses on research and societal implementation of climate adaptation and mitigation strategies, as well as supporting TCFD and TNFD disclosures.

The National Institute for Environmental Studies (NIES), led by President Yoshito Oshima, and Chugin Financial Group, led by President Sadanori Kato, have signed a comprehensive partnership agreement. The collaboration aims to contribute to regional sustainable development (the construction of a 'Regional Circular and Ecological Sphere') by leveraging the strengths of both organizations to conduct research on the sustainable use of environmental (natural) capital.

This marks the first comprehensive partnership NIES has established with a financial institution.

■ Sustainability as a Key to Regional and Business Growth

Under this agreement, NIES and Chugin FG will promote research and societal implementation related to environmental capital, which forms the basis of the environment, economy, and society. By conducting long-term, continuous activities, they aim to further promote regional development.

■ Contents of the Comprehensive Partnership Agreement

(1) Purpose
To promote mutual cooperation and activities, matching regional needs with cutting-edge research, thereby contributing to regional sustainable development.

(2) Areas of Cooperation
1. Research, study, and societal implementation of climate change adaptation and mitigation measures.
2. Research, study, and societal implementation of nature coexistence and biodiversity.
3. Utilization of environmental capital and regional awareness-raising to solve environmental problems.

(3) Effective Period
Three years from May 26, 2026, to May 25, 2029 (extendable upon written mutual agreement).

■ Future Initiatives (Examples)
- Support for TCFD compliance and spreading awareness of adaptation measures among regional businesses (e.g., holding seminars).
- Research on the climate change adaptation effects of wooden architecture.
- Research and practical implementation of mitigation technologies in industrial zones.
- Consideration of TNFD compliance and the practice of Nature Positive/NbS (Nature-based Solutions).
